HOW LONG WILL MY CAKES STAY FRESH FOR?

All our products are made without artificial preservatives and we always recommend eating them on the day to enjoy them at their best. Depending on your needs you may want to get your cakes a day before you plan to serve them, and that's fine too - just store in their boxes at room temperature, or in the fridge if the weather is very warm.

When storing cake in the fridge always allow it to come to room temperature before serving - please note that for large cakes this can take several hours. In the (unlikely) event you find that you have cupcakes left over they’ll stay fresh for a day or so in their box, or an additional day in an airtight container. It is possible to freeze our cakes but we recommend storing them in an airtight container in your freezer between -18 and -22 degrees Celsius for no longer than 1 month. They are best defrosted in the fridge overnight.

 

WHAT SIZE ARE YOUR CUPCAKES?

Our Big Cupcakes are standard cupcake size, about 2.5" diameter and our mini cupcakes are 1.5" in diameter. Big Cupcakes give about 4-5 bites and minis are bite-sized.

 

WHAT SIZE ARE YOUR CAKES?

Our Cakes are available in 4", 6”, 8”, 10” & 12" diameter and are approx 6”-7" high depending on flavour and decoration. A 4" cake provides 4-6 generous servings; 6” cakes serve 12-14, 8” cakes serve 22-24, 10” 34-36 and 12" 48-50.
